Product Description

Copiapoa humilis is a charming and compact cactus endemic to the arid regions of Chile. This species forms small, low-growing clusters with individual stems that are globular to cylindrical in shape. The dark green to brownish stems are adorned with prominent ribs and short, stout spines that are usually yellow to brown. During the summer, it produces small, yellow flowers that emerge from the apex of the stems, adding a vibrant touch to its otherwise muted appearance. Copiapoa humilis is well-suited for rock gardens, containers, and succulent collections, prized for its hardiness and unique form.

Cultivation

Soil: Use a well-draining cactus or succulent mix, preferably sandy or rocky.

Watering: Water deeply but infrequently, allowing soil to dry completely between waterings.

Light: Requires full sun for optimal growth but can tolerate partial shade.

Temperature: Prefers warm temperatures; protect from frost.

Fertilization: Apply a balanced cactus fertilizer during the growing season.

Pruning: Minimal pruning needed; remove dead or damaged parts.

Pests: Monitor for mealybugs and spider mites; treat infestations promptly.
